Abstract: Various aspects of the present disclosure generally relate to wireless communication. In some aspects, a first user equipment (UE) may transmit, to a second UE, a first message to indicate a sidelink bandwidth part (BWP) switch, for the first UE, to a first sidelink BWP, wherein the first message includes an indication of the first sidelink BWP and a first sidelink resource pool in the first sidelink BWP. The UE may receive, from the second UE, a second message that confirms the sidelink BWP switch for the first UE. The UE may transmit, to the second UE, a third message to activate the sidelink BWP switch, for the first UE, to the first sidelink BWP, based at least in part on receiving the second message that confirms the sidelink BWP switch. Numerous other aspects are described.

Abstract: Various aspects of the present disclosure generally relate to wireless communication. In some aspects, a user equipment (UE) may receive a sidelink configuration that indicates a set of sidelink slots comprising a first subset of sidelink slots to be used for first transmissions of sidelink communications and a second subset of sidelink slots to be used for second transmissions of the sidelink communications. The UE may communicate based at least in part on the sidelink configuration. Numerous other aspects are described.

Abstract: Methods, systems, and devices for wireless communications are described. A user equipment (UE) may store configurations for candidate physical cell identifiers (PCIs) that the UE may select from for inter-cell mobility. A base station or a UE or both may identify a first configuration indicating a number of configured PCIs for inter-cell mobility operations. The base station or the UE or both may identify a second configuration indicating a number of selected PCIs for inter-cell mobility operations. In some cases, the selected PCIs may be a subset of the configured PCIs. Identifying the number of configured PCIs and the number of selected PCIs by the base station and UE may be based on a capability report configured by the UE. The UE and the base station may perform an inter-cell mobility operation based on stored cell configurations associated with the configured PCIs and the selected PCIs.

Abstract: Apparatus, methods, and computer-readable media for facilitating per bandwidth part TCI state or spatial relation are disclosed herein. For example, aspects disclosed herein provide techniques for enabling a UE (e.g., a reduced capability UE) to associate at least one of a TCI state or a spatial relation with respective hopping regions. An example method for wireless communication at a UE includes determining, while communicating using a first frequency range comprising a first set of frequency hops, at least one of a TCI state or a spatial relation for communicating using a second frequency range comprising a second set of frequency hops. The example method also includes communicating, after switching communication from the first frequency range to the second frequency range, using the second frequency range based on the determined at least one of the TCI state or the spatial relation.

Abstract: Methods, systems, and devices for wireless communication are described. A first network node may receive information via a first cell. The information may indicate a resource allocation for transmission of an initial uplink message via a second cell. The initial uplink message is a first uplink transmission scheduled to occur between the first network node and a second network node after a handover of the first network node from the first cell to the second cell. The first network node may receive a command via the first cell. The command may trigger the handover of the first network node from the first cell to the second cell. In response to the command message, the first network node may transmit the initial uplink message via the second cell.

Abstract: Certain aspects of the present disclosure provide techniques for wireless communications by a user equipment (UE), comprising receiving, from a network entity, an uplink grant indicating uplink resources, allocating the uplink resources to one or more logical channels (LCHs) based on a procedure that takes into account relative packet transmission delay bounds for at least a first LCH of the LCHs, and transmitting, to the network entity, traffic for the LCHs on the uplink resources in accordance with the allocation.

Abstract: Various aspects of the present disclosure generally relate to wireless communication. In some aspects, a transmitter may perform a first encoding operation on source packets that generates a first set of network coding encoded packets and may broadcast the first set of network coding encoded packets for reception by a plurality of receivers. The transmitter may receive feedback information associated with the first set of network coding encoded packets, the feedback information indicating that a first subset of network coding encoded packets were received by at least one of the plurality of receivers, the feedback information further indicating that one or more receivers of the plurality of receivers did not successfully recover all of the plurality of source packets. The transmitter may broadcast a second set of network coding encoded packets that does not include any of the first subset of network coding encoded packets. Numerous other aspects are provided.

Abstract: Various aspects of the present disclosure generally relate to wireless communication. In some aspects, a first user equipment (UE) may communicate with a second UE using a sidelink channel and a first beam. The UE may transmit a sidelink beam report associated with the first beam to a network entity. The UE may receive sidelink configuration information from the network entity that indicates to change from using the sidelink channel and the first beam to using the sidelink channel and a second beam. The UE may communicate with the second UE using the sidelink channel and the second beam. Numerous other aspects are described.

Abstract: Aspects of the present disclosure relate to wireless communications, and more particularly, to techniques for beam refinement via physical random access channel (PRACH) repetition. A method that may be performed by a network entity includes determining resources to monitor for a PRACH transmission sent from a user equipment (UE) as part of a random access channel (RACH) procedure, performing receive beam sweeping when receiving PRACH repetitions sent using the determined resources, using results of the receive beam sweeping to refine one or more beams and to select a refined beam of the refined one or more beams, and using the selected refined beam for at least one of receiving a subsequent message from the UE as part of the RACH procedure or sending a subsequent message to the UE as part of the RACH procedure.
